About 19 Colvin Gardens
19 Colvin Gardens is a three-bedroom end-of-terrace house in Redbridge, London, London (E11 2DD). It has a recorded floor area of 124 m² (around 1335 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(September 2022) shows a D (score 65),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in May 2021 the rating was F,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Good, window ef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good; while hot-water efficiency dropped from Average to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 82), a 2-band jump. Main heating runs on electricity.
At 124 m² the property is well over the postcode median (91 m² across 24 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. 2 planning records sit against the property, 1 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Today's modelled estimate of £934,000 is 25.4%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£558/sq ft) was about 68.4%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£745,000 in July 2021.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
